码农,第一次听到这个称呼,你一定不会和程序员联系在一起,开始学习之后,在学长和老师的熏陶之下,慢慢习惯了码农这个称呼,但是,你知道程序员为什么叫码农吗??小编接下来就带你进入程序员的另一个世界~ 对于很多大一的同学来说,他们只知道自己未来的职业是一名程序员,但是有几个人知道程序员是干什么的呢?小编先来说说程序员这个职业吧! 程序员是从事程序开发、维护的专业人员。一般将程序员分为程序设计人员和程序编码人员,但两者的界限并不非常清楚,特别是在中国。软件从业人员分为初级程序员、中级程序员、高级程序员、系统分析员、系统架构师等。 回归到刚开始的问题,程序员为什么叫码农呢? 其实码农,是程序员对自己职业的一自嘲。为什么这么说呢?原因很简单,就是把编程生涯与田间地头的锄禾日当午联系起来了,这时候只要你仔细想想,也许真的有那么几分相似,田间整齐栽种的秧苗,与屏幕上显示的错落有致的代码行有几分神似。各种庄稼的种植是有讲究的,正如要注意编程风格。施肥灌溉:犹如对代码进行的编译链接。除草除虫:自然是在做着debug,挑水浇园:大概是在小菜园中进行的结对编程。码农这个叫法让人体会更多的是滑稽、搞怪、无厘头。毕竟一个是简单的体力劳动,一个是高智商的脑力劳动,不可同日而语。 田间整齐栽种的秧苗 屏幕上显示的错落有致的代码 各种庄稼的种植是有讲究的 每种编程语言的方法是不同的 对代码进行的编译链接是不是和农民的施肥灌溉有几分相似呢 再来看看这个,农民除草除害和我们处理debug的心情是不是一样呢? 另外,我们还有自己的别称哦!可能很多人都知道,那就是程序猿~ 小编提醒大家:程序猿和程序员有很大的区别哦!程序员不是你们眼中的程序猿,程序猿是一种非常特殊的、可以从事程序开发、维护的动物,是一种近几十年来出现的新物种,是信息革命的产物,在行为和物种归类上我们也可称为码字猿。 所以我们毕业之后,走向社会那时候,并不能称为程序员,只能叫做码农或者程序猿,距离真正的程序员还有很长的路要走 那么小编介绍一下真正的程序员吧!也可以使我们这些程序猿早日转变为程序员~ 对于真正的程序员(非初级程序员,也即码农)而言,他们不仅是枚资深的码农,还熟悉与客户沟通的技巧,在帮助用户解决问题的时候了解用户的需求,进而迭代产品;他们可以深谙获取用户需求的技巧,也懂得市场分析、技术执行分析、价值分析估算项目的风险;他们能独立完成项目使用文档的能力,甚至都可以独立完成一个项目。他们与纯粹的码农有一个非常显著的差异:码农靠体力为生,真正的程序员不仅体力行,其也靠脑力,靠思维逻辑上的突破、靠团队管理赢得个人魅力。 ---END--- 小编:逐天 |
|
声明:文章版权归原作者所有 部分文章转自互联网 如有侵权请联系
[邮箱地址] 删除
|